Hydrogen Fuel - Energy
www1.eere.energy.govProton exchange membrane fuel cells were first used by NASA in the 1960’s as part of the Gemini space program, and were used on seven missions. Those fuel cells used pure oxygen and hydrogen as the reactant gases and were small-scale, expensive and not commercially viable. Hydrogen Technologies Safety Guide - NREL
www.nrel.govprimarily proton exchange membrane (PEM) fuel cells. PEM fuel cells are the preferred fuel cell technology for vehicles and other new applications because of their fast start-up time and low operating temperature. These fuel cells are used for stationary power, primarily in backup power units, and to produce electricity for electric vehicles.
